'Black Panther' beats 'Justice League' total box office in just four days

"Black Panther" still reigns supreme.

The Ryan Coogler-directed superhero movie is expected to make a whopping $235 million in its first four days in theaters over the long weekend, putting it ahead of opening weekends for blockbusters like "Jurassic World" and "The Avengers."

That total would also beat last year's "Justice League," which brought in just $228.6 million at the domestic box office over its entire run.

"Star Wars: The Force Awakens" holds the box office record for a movie's first four days at $288 million, with "The Last Jedi" at $241.5 million.

"Black Panther" stars Chadwick Boseman, Michael B. Jordan, Lupita Nyong'o and Angela Bassett.
